The two-magnon spectrum for the Heisenberg ferromagnet with NN interactions on a square lattice

Abstract
The two-magnon spectrum of the nearest-neighbour Heisenberg ferromagnet on a square lattice is studied. An exact Green function formalism is used to obtain the spectral functions at zero temperature. The lattice Green functions of this system are written in terms of elliptic integrals. The behaviour of the spectral functions at the critical points is studied analytically. Plots of the spectral functions against energy are given for some values of the wave-vector and their various features are discussed. Comparisons with the analogous 3D and 1D systems are made.Keywords
